Overview
-
Maintain compliance with BACB ethics standards and applicable regulations and company policies under the supervision of the Clinic Director.
-
Conduct Functional Behavior Assessment (FBA) and related clinical assessments; develop, oversee, and refine data-driven, function-based Behavior Intervention Plans (BIPs).
-
Collect, analyze, and evaluate behavioral data to monitor client progress and intervention effectiveness; review data collection systems to ensure accuracy, fidelity, and consistency, and provide objective feedback to improve outcomes.
-
Model behavioral strategies through direct client work; coach and mentor staff on behavior intervention strategies and ethical practices.
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
-
Current BCBA certification in good standing
-
Master’s degree in Behavior Analysis, Psychology, Education, or related field
-
Minimum of two years of experience (three or more preferred) supporting individuals with autism and/or related emotional, mental health, neurological, or developmental disabilities in residential, educational, or intensive care settings.
-
Ability to work independently and collaboratively while exercising sound clinical judgment, problem-solving skills, and culturally responsive practices with diverse populations.
-
Flexibility to travel between sites and adjust schedules as needed, including occasional non-standard hours, to meet program and client needs.
